A6B595KLW-T Description
The A6B595KLW-T is a power driver IC designed for high efficiency and performance in various electronic applications. Manufactured by Allegro MicroSystems, this obsolete product remains a reliable choice for power management solutions. It features a low-side output configuration with a maximum output current of 150mA, making it suitable for driving multiple loads efficiently. The device operates within a supply voltage range of 4.5V to 5.5V, ensuring compatibility with a wide range of power supplies. With a maximum load voltage of 50V, it can handle significant power demands while maintaining a low on-resistance (Rds On) of 5.5Ohm, which minimizes power loss and heat generation.
The A6B595KLW-T is housed in a surface-mount package, specifically a 20SOIC, which is ideal for compact and space-constrained designs. It features a latched driver switch type, providing stable and reliable operation. The device also includes a 1:8 input-to-output ratio, enabling efficient control of multiple outputs with minimal input signals. It supports strobe and serial interfaces, making it versatile for various control applications. The device is REACH unaffected and RoHS3 compliant, ensuring it meets environmental and safety standards. With a moisture sensitivity level (MSL) of 1 (unlimited), it is suitable for storage and handling in various environments.
